Summary

(John  20:19-23) Are you simply a follower of Jesus? Or are you a true disciple? When it could cost you something, how close will you be following? Join Evangelist Scott Pauley as He brings this third message from John 20.  (06163220709)  Join Scott Pauley's study through Scripture this year.
